The campaign targets Iran’s drone and missile networks, specifically degrading the assets that allow Tehran to threaten maritime traffic in the Strait of Hormuz. Despite sustained damage from combined U.S. and Israeli operations, the Iranian military retains the capacity to project power, prompting internal deliberations within the Trump administration regarding more aggressive maneuvers, including a potential strike on Kharg Island.
While the Pentagon remains silent on the specific tactical objectives, the current operational tempo suggests a calculated effort to erode Iran’s strategic depth. The collapse of peace negotiations has left the administration with limited alternatives, turning the focus toward physical neutralization of threats that officials believe are no longer manageable through traditional statecraft.
